After applying the 30% federal tax credit, net costs typically range from $10,500 to $24,500. Understanding solar costs requires grasping two key metrics: cost per watt and cost per kilowatt-hour (kWh).
That change has made solar more accessible for many more homeowners. However, costs vary among states. Here are the average costs for installing residential solar panels by state according to EnergySage data. $30,427. $3.12. $18,799. $2.07. $23,164. $2.50. $14,476.
Another measure of the relative cost of solar energy is its price per kilowatt-hour (kWh). Whereas the price per watt considers the solar system’s size, the price per kWh shows the price of the solar system per unit of energy it produces over a given period of time. Net cost of the system / lifetime output = cost per kilowatt hour

A single solar battery typically costs, on average, $5,097, depending on capacity, type, and brand.* For whole-house backup systems with more than 25 kWh capacity, costs can exceed $25,000, not including installation. The price varies significantly based on storage capacity and brand.
Inverter: A solar inverter converts the generated DC electricity into AC electricity that can be used to power your home. The cost of an inverter depends on its size and efficiency, but these devices typically cost between $1,000 and $3,000. Mounting system: This is what holds rooftop solar panels in place.
